GoPro IOS app connection
[ New ]Ever since the new app upgrade for the GoPro app, when you tap on "Add a camera" this message pops up "Bluetooth Is Off: Turn on bluetooth in your iphones Settings, then try connecting to your GoPro again". My iPhones bluetooth is on during this and i am sure of it. The GoPro that I am trying to connect is a GoPro HERO Session and it does not seem to have any options for connecting via bluetooth. I am able to turn on the wifi pairing and then connect to the gopros wifi in the iphone's wifi settings. But this does not get me anywhere since the gopro app still prompts me to connect with bluetooth. What can i do?
